‘During the winter of 1928-9 a special committee under the chairmanship of Seebohm Rowntree attempted to distil the national development segments of the Liberal Party’s Industrial Inquiry’s report on Britain’s Industrial Future into an election programme. Keynes attended many of the meetings which ultimately produced a pamphlet We Can Conquer Unemployment, soon nicknamed the Orange Book because of the colour of its cover. Keynes became one of the leading defenders of the proposals against Conservative opposition’ (Moggridge, Maynard Keynes: An Economist’s Biography, p. 462).
